Programming Engineer in Japan : Pay and Career Trajectories
Becoming a software engineer in Japan presents compelling prospects for career growth. Pay rates for junior engineers typically range from ¥4 million to ¥6 million each year, while senior engineers can receive anywhere from ¥8 million to ¥15 million or more . Career paths can include specializing in areas like artificial intelligence , cloud computing , or mobile development . Advancement often involves moving into leadership roles , such as engineering manager or principal lead. Furthermore the need for skilled application engineers remains significant, offering longevity and potential for enhanced development .
